The left-handed edition of the Jeff Loomis Signature 7-String offers the same powerful EMG 707 active humbuckers and an extended scale length, providing an incredible 7-string instrument full of meat and crunch! The ash body with 26.5-inch scale maple neck is durable and tonal while the Grover tuners and TonePros bridge offer incredible stability to ensure perfect tune every time. The Ultra Access neck-joint provides that extra space need to reach the higher frets comfortably.

Schecter Jeff Loomis Left-Handed 7-String Guitar Features

- Ash body and maple set-neck with Ultra Access
- 24-fret, maple fingerboard
- Active EMG 707 humbuckers
- TonePros TOM with thru-body
- Grover tuners and black chrome hardware

- Construction: Set-Neck with Ultra Access
- Body: Ash
- Neck: Maple
- Scale: 26.5 inches
- Tuning: B/E/A/D/G/B/E
- Fingerboard: Maple
- Frets: 24 Jumbo
- Inlays: Metal Cross
- Binding: Black (Neck and Headstock)
- Nut: GraphTech Tusq
- Pickups: Active EMG 707
- Electronics: Volume, 3-way Switch
- Bridge: TonePros TOM with Thru-Body
- Tuners: Grover
- Hardware: Black Chrome

I am completely new to 7 string guitars and with this guitar, I'll never buy a six string again. The maple fingerboard and ash body are surprisingly light, I thought the guitar was going to much heavier and I love the tone that it produces. Not really too many features,This guitar is very simple with a 3 way pickup selector and 1 volume knob, but I like it that way, The guitars satin finish is really smooth and makes going up and down the fretboard very easy and comfortable. Although I've had guitars with thinner necks, something about the comfort of this neck enables me to play just as fast or it not faster. My only complaint is that it is kinda hard to play up to the 23rd and 24th frets, but it is a minor inconvenience to me. This guitar feels really solid and comfortable in your hands. This is the best guitar I have ever owned and one of the best guitar I have ever played. Although almost 1000 is expensive, it's truly worth every penny for this amazing and quality instrument, Expecially in a market where there isn't many choices for left handed players.
Sound
Even when not plugged in, it still gives a bright and clear sound. The EMGs have a good response and a tight bottom end response too.
